Output 6a90814f43bb7bb562a44da734b864280f54017cabc74cb747fe94de293967ee:2

value
108586349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94a232ef51c992e81fb8b42540dd4cc96b4af77 OP_EQUAL
address
3H88w841uWDie8vz6J61kYvSmmndcu9N9a
transaction
6a90814f43bb7bb562a44da734b864280f54017cabc74cb747fe94de293967ee
confirmations
346343
spent
true